To re-download the latest image update simply re-execute the above command from the same initial location.
However, any subsequent attempts to update your previously downloaded image will be much faster. The initial download will take some time. Example of Ubuntu 20.04 download using zsync: $ zsync Use the *.zsync download URL as an argument to the zsync command. Next, see the above Ubuntu 20.04 download table and locate the relevant *.zsync download URL by browsing the download page of your desired Ubuntu flavor. Let’s start by installation of the zsync command: $ sudo apt install zsync zsync is a differential file download client which will keep your ISO up to date for any changes by downloading only the updated ISO image blocks. In case you need to constantly have the latest Ubuntu 20.04 ISO at your disposal the recommended Ubuntu 20.04 ISO image download is by using the zsync command.
